Church traditions

Church traditions refer to the practices, rituals, and beliefs that have been passed down within Christian communities over time. They encompass elements such as liturgical practices, interpretation of scripture, and moral teachings. Traditions can vary among different denominations and reflect historical, cultural, and theological influences. While some traditions are rooted in biblical texts, others have developed through communal worship and shared experiences. These traditions help shape the identity of a church community and guide its members in faith and worship, often providing a sense of continuity and connection to the past.
